Keith Brown wrote:


The problem is that they want to *try* Linux but,
unless they have a spare machine, preserve their
existing Windows install. Thus Linux has to play nice
with Windows, whereas Windows doesn't care about
playing nice with Linux.

one could always install linux in the windows partition, using the umsdos filesystem, which maps linux filenames onto dos filenames. Thus, someone wanting to give it a whirl might not actually need to repartition.


http://www.tldp.org/HOWTO/UMSDOS-HOWTO.html

Although, I should add, I've never actually tried it and I'm not sure if recent Linux distros offer it as a standard option.
